Peripheral monocyte transcriptomics associated with immune checkpoint blockade outcomes in metastatic melanoma

2024-01-25

Abstract excerpt

<h4>ABSTRACT</h4> Clinical responses to immune checkpoint blockade (ICB) for metastatic melanoma (MM) are variable, with patients frequently developing immune related adverse events (irAEs). The role played by myeloid populations in modulating responses to ICB remains poorly defined.
